About

Buschberg - Vorwerk is a local ski area in Germany operated by the Schiverein Lengefeld. The facility features a ski lift and serves as a community hub for winter sports activities in the Lengefeld region.

Frequently Asked Questions

How many lifts does Buschberg - Vorwerk have?

Buschberg - Vorwerk has 1 ski lifts.

What is the vertical drop at Buschberg - Vorwerk?

Buschberg - Vorwerk has a vertical drop of 269 feet (82 meters).

What is the peak elevation of Buschberg - Vorwerk?

The summit of Buschberg - Vorwerk sits at 2,100 feet (640 meters) above sea level.

How many trails does Buschberg - Vorwerk have?

Buschberg - Vorwerk has 1 marked trails, totaling roughly 0.37 miles of skiing.

Does Buschberg - Vorwerk offer night skiing?

Yes, Buschberg - Vorwerk offers night skiing. Hours and trail availability vary by season, so check the official website for current schedules.

Does Buschberg - Vorwerk have snowmaking?

No, Buschberg - Vorwerk relies on natural snowfall and does not operate snowmaking equipment.

How much snow does Buschberg - Vorwerk get each year?

Buschberg - Vorwerk averages around 19.69 inches (50 cm) of snowfall per season.

How long is the longest run at Buschberg - Vorwerk?

The longest run at Buschberg - Vorwerk is approximately 0.37 miles (0.6 km).
